How did it all end up like this? Since when... did everything go to hell? Well... actually, you knew: from the moment you married Henry, your life ceased to be your own. Henry Hamilton is the most famous actor of the moment; a celebrity in every sense of the word. Wealth, connections, fame, roles... But what no one knew was that he was a damned monster: cynical, manipulative, and with a tyrannical character that made anyone who dared to do anything wrong in his presence shudder. You didn't know this until you were already husband and wife. You were also a renowned actress, but your popularity skyrocketed after marrying Henry, who soon revealed his true colors behind the doors of his mansion. Three years of hell and abuse followed, until he and his lover murdered you with a coldness that would have made your stomach boil with rage if it weren't for the fact that, well, there was little you could do once you were dead... or so you thought. They made it look like an accident. They ended up with their happy ending... What you didn't expect was that, out of nowhere, you appeared three years in the past, before you married Henry, before the controversies, before his manipulation, before everything. You started from scratch. Or, well, not exactly. Just at the beginning of filming the movie you starred in with Henry, when your fame exploded. You knew this movie would be the one that would catapult you to stardom, and you had to take advantage of it. You were in your dressing room when you regained your sense of what was happening, surrounded by your makeup artists, since they would soon have a press conference about the film. Just then, there was a knock at your door, and {{char}} , the film's director, appeared. A luminary in the world of cinema, and one whose feelings for you in your past life you only learned much later. "Sorry to interrupt. Are you ready? Everyone's on the bus." He said in his characteristically cold tone, though he exuded a confident and warm aura that was exclusively for you. What will you do?
